CHF15.90
Download steht sofort bereit
Learning AngularJS
Get started with AngularJS web development fast
AngularJS is one of the most exciting and innovative new technologies emerging in the world of web development. Designed to simplify the development and testing of web applications, it also provides structure for the entire development process.
Websites are no longer simple static content-instead, websites have become much more dynamic, with a single page often serving as the entire site or application. And AngularJS allows web developers to build the necessary programming logic for such applications directly into a web page, binding the data model for the client web application to backend services and databases. AngularJS also allows the extension of HTML so that the UI design logic can be expressed easily in an HTML template file.
Learning AngularJS shows you how to create powerful, interactive web applications that have a well-structured, reusable code base that will be easy to maintain. You'll also learn how to leverage AngularJS's innovative MVC approach to implement well-designed and well-structured web pages and web applications.
Design unit and end-to-end tests for AngularJS applications Contents at a Glance 1 Jumping Into JavaScript
Manipulating Strings
Adding Error Handling 2 Getting Started with AngularJS
Using jQuery or jQuery Lite in AngularJS Applications 3 Understanding AngularJS Application Dynamics
Applying Configuration and Run Blocks to Modules 4 Implementing the Scope as a Data Model
Implementing Scope Hierarchy 5 Using AngularJS Templates to Create Views
Creating Custom Filters 6 Implementing Directives in AngularJS Views
Using Built-in Directives 7 Creating Your Own Custom Directives to Extend HTML
Implementing Custom Directives 8 Using Events to Interact with Data in the Model
Emitting and Broadcasting Custom Events 9 Implementing AngularJS Services in Web Applications
Using the $q Service to Provide Deferred Responses 10 Creating Your Own Custom AngularJS Services
Integrating Custom Services into Your AngularJS Applications 11 Creating Rich Web Application Components the AngularJS Way
Adding Star Ratings to Elements A Testing AngularJS Applications
Autorentext
Brad Dayley is a senior software engineer with over 20 years of experience developing enterprise applications and Web interfaces. He has a passion for new technologies, especially ones that really make a difference in the software industry. He has used JavaScript, jQuery, and AngularJS for years and is the author of Node.js, MongoDB and AngularJS Web Development (Addison-Wesley Professional), jQuery and JavaScript Phrasebook (Addison-Wesley Professional), and Sams Teach Yourself jQuery and JavaScript in 24 Hours (Sams Publishing). He has designed and implemented a wide array of applications and services from application servers to complex 2.0 web interfaces.
Inhalt
1 Jumping Into JavaScript
Adding Error Handling 2 Getting Started with AngularJS
Using jQuery or jQuery Lite in AngularJS Applications 3 Understanding AngularJS Application Dynamics
Applying Configuration and Run Blocks to Modules 4 Implementing the Scope as a Data Model
Implementing Scope Hierarchy 5 Using AngularJS Templates to Create Views
Creating Custom Filters 6 Implementing Directives in AngularJS Views
Using Built-in Directives 7 Creating Your Own Custom Directives to Extend HTML
Implementing Custom Directives 8 Using Events to Interact with Data in the Model
Emitting and Broadcasting Custom Events 9 Implementing AngularJS Services in Web Applications
Using the $q Service to Provide Deferred Responses 10 Creating Your Own Custom AngularJS Services
Integrating Custom Services into Your AngularJS Applications 11 Creating Rich Web Application Components the AngularJS Way
Adding Star Ratings to Elements A Testing AngularJS Applications